基于环路的码率兼容多元LDPC码打孔算法  

A Cycle-based Puncturing Algorithm for Rate-compatible Non-binary LDPC Codes

在线阅读下载全文

作  者:谢莉 周华[1] 石双颖 XIE Li;ZHOU Hua;SHI Shuangying(School of Electronic and Information Engineering,Nanjing University of Information Science and Technology,Nanjing 210044)

机构地区:[1]南京信息工程大学电子与信息工程学院,南京210044

出  处:《计算机与数字工程》2025年第1期31-35,共5页Computer & Digital Engineering

基  金:国家自然科学基金项目(编号:61771248)资助。

摘  要:LDPC(Low Density Parity Check)码是无线通信系统中高效的信道编码技术,并已经在第五代移动通信等系统中应用,码率兼容则是在应用中遇到的重要问题之一。码率兼容的关键在于在不增加译码复杂度的情况下,实现低码率到高码率的任意变化。论文提出了一种码率兼容多元LDPC码的比特级打孔算法。该算法首先将多元符号矩阵转换为二元比特矩阵,其次利用最小环路检测算法检测每个比特变量节点所在环路大小,并选择大环路比特变量节点进行打孔。仿真结果表明,针对码长256、码率0.5的非规则四元LDPC码及码长155、码率0.4得规则LDPC码,论文所提算法均大约有0.1dB~0.25 dB的增益。LDPC(Low-Density-Parity-Check)codes are an efficient channel coding technique for wireless communication systems and are used in systems such as fifth generation mobile communications.The key to rate compatibility is to achieve arbitrary changes from low to high rates without increasing the complexity of decoding.A bitwise puncturing algorithm for rate compatible non-binary LDPC codes is proposed.The algorithm firstly converts the non-binary symbol matrix into a binary bit matrix,and sec⁃ondly uses a minimum cycle detection algorithm to evaluate the cycle size for each bit variable node involved in,and punctures bit variable nodes in large cycles.Simulation results show that the proposed algorithm achieves a gain of approximately 0.1 dB~0.25 dB for both non-regular LDPC codes of block length 256 and rate 0.5 and regular LDPC codes of code length 155 and code rate 0.4 over GF(4).

关 键 词:多元LDPC码 码率兼容 打孔 环路 比特级 

分 类 号:TN911.22[电子电信—通信与信息系统]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象